数字信号处理实验报告西安交通大学

数字信号处理实验报告西安交通大学

ID:13258357

大小:687.10 KB

页数:29页

时间:2018-07-21

数字信号处理实验报告西安交通大学_第1页
数字信号处理实验报告西安交通大学_第2页
数字信号处理实验报告西安交通大学_第3页
数字信号处理实验报告西安交通大学_第4页
数字信号处理实验报告西安交通大学_第5页
资源描述:

《数字信号处理实验报告西安交通大学》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、西安交通大学电子信息与工程学院自动化科学与技术系数字信号处理实验报告实验名称 :数字信号处理实验者姓名:XX实验者学号:21105040XX所在班级:自动化1X报告完成日期:2013年12月15日实验1常见离散信号的MATLAB产生和图形显示一、实验目的:加深对常用离散信号的理解二、实验原理:1、单位抽样序列在MATLAB中可以利用zeros()函数实现。如果在时间轴上延迟了k个单位,得到即:2、单位阶跃序列在MATLAB中可以利用ones()函数实现。3、正弦序列在MATLAB中4、复正弦序列在MATLAB中5、指数序

2、列在MATLAB中一、实验内容:1、单位抽样序列代码示例:x=zeros(1,10);x(1)=1;stem(x,’.r’)xlabel('n')ylabel('y')title('单位抽样信号δ(1)')1、单位阶跃序列代码示例:x=ones(1,10);stem(x,’.r’)xlabel('n')ylabel('y')title('单位阶跃信号u(n)')1、正弦序列代码示例:f=3;Fs=14;fai=pi/3;n=0:29;t=0:0.1:29;y=2*sin(2*pi*f*n/Fs+fai);z=2*sin(

3、2*pi*f*t/Fs+fai);holdonplot(t,z,':')stem(n,y,'r')xlabel('n')ylabel('y')title('正弦序列信号y=2*sin(2*pi*f*n/Fs+fai)')1、复正弦序列图6代码示例:w=pi/3;n=0:29;t=0:0.1:29;y=exp(j*w*n);z=exp(j*w*t);holdonplot(t,z,':')stem(n,y,'r')xlabel('n')ylabel('y')title('复指数序列信号y=exp(j*w*n)其中w=pi/3

4、')复指数序列性质讨论:对于复指数序列y=exp(j*w*n),当2π/w为有理数时,此时复指数序列y=exp(j*w*n)以2π*k/w(k取使2π*k/w为整数的最小正整数)为最小正周期的离散信号,反之,则为一般的非周期离散信号,例如当w=1/3,如上图61、指数序列当a=1/2时:当a=1/2+(sqrt(2)/2)*j时:当a=2时:代码示例:a=2;n=0:29;y=a.^n;stem(n,y,'r')xlabel('n')ylabel('y')title('指数序列信号y=a.^n其中a=2')实验2离散系统

5、的差分方程、单位脉冲响应和卷积分析一、实验目的:加深对离散系统的差分方程、单位脉冲响应和卷积分析方法的理解。二、实验原理:离散系统其输入、输出关系可用以下差分方程描述:输入信号分解为单位脉冲序列,。记系统单位脉冲响应,则系统响应为如下的卷积计算式:当时,h[n]是有限长度的(n:[0,M]),称系统为FIR系统;反之,称系统为IIR系统。在MATLAB中,可以用函数y=Filter(p,d,x)求解差分方程,也可以用函数y=Conv(x,h)计算卷积。三、实验内容:1、理论计算单位冲击响应为:h(n)=-6*(-1/5)

6、^n*u(n)+7*(-2/5)^n*u(n)1)第一个差分方程程序为:N=12;n=0:N-1;d=[1,0.6,0.08];p=[1,-1,0];x1=[n==0];%x1为单位脉冲序列y1=filter(p,d,x1);subplot(2,1,1),stem(n,y1);xlabel('n');ylabel('y1(n)');title('单位冲激响应')x2=[n>=0];%x2为单位阶跃序列y2=filter(p,d,x2);subplot(2,1,2),stem(n,y2);xlabel('n');ylabe

7、l('y2(n)');title('单位阶跃响应')截图如下:2、理论计算单位冲击响应为:h(n)=0.2*[δ(n-1)+δ(n-2)+δ(n-3)+δ(n-4)+δ(n-5)]2、第二个差分方程程序为:N=12;n=0:N-1;p=[0,0.2,0.2,0.2,0.2,0.2,0.2];d=[1,0,0,0,0,0,0];x1=[n==0];%x1为单位脉冲序列y1=filter(p,d,x1);subplot(2,1,1),stem(n,y1);xlabel('n');ylabel('y1(n)');title('

8、单位冲激响应')x2=[n>=0];%x2为单位脉冲序列y2=filter(p,d,x2);subplot(2,1,2),stem(n,y2);xlabel('n');ylabel('y2(n)');title('单位阶跃响应')截图如下:实验3离散系统的频率响应分析和零、极点分布实验目的:加深对离散系统的频率响应分

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。